Legacy_information[Chin G, Villeneuve AM] me41 homozyotes are viable hermaphrodite, morphologically normal;98% of eggs fail to hatch, Him: 24% of viable progeny are male. Defective in meiotic recombination and chiasma formation, radiation-induced chromosome damage, but not in DNA-damage-induced apoptosis. ok179 similar. Encoding ortholog of budding yeast Mre11p

Structured_descriptionConcise_descriptionmre-11 encodes a protein orthologous to S. cerevisiae MRE11 and to human MRE11A (OMIM:600814, mutated in ataxia-telangiectasia-like disorder); MRE-11 is required for meiotic recombination and DNA repair in C. elegans, for multigenerational persistence of the germline, and (in conjunction with CHK-2 and SPO-11) for the localization of RAD-51 to foci in late zygotene/early pachytene nuclei.Paper_evidenceWBPaper00004596

Automated_descriptionPredicted to enable single-stranded DNA endodeoxyribonuclease activity. Predicted to be involved in DNA damage response and nucleic acid metabolic process. Located in nucleus. Human ortholog(s) of this gene implicated in several diseases, including Alzheimer's disease; Lynch syndrome; endometrial cancer; and gastrointestinal system cancer (multiple). Is an ortholog of human MRE11 (MRE11 homolog, double strand break repair nuclease).Paper_evidenceWBPaper00065943
